The Fear Merchants

Written by: Philip Levene
Directed by: Gordon Flemyng
Guest Stars: Patrick Cargill (Pemberton), Brian Wilde (Jeremy Raven),
Annette Carell (Dr. Voss), Garfield Morgan (Gilbert),
Andrew Keir (Crawley), Jeremy Burnham (Gordon White),
Edward Burnham (Meadows), Bernard Horsfall (Fox),
Ruth Trouncer (Dr. Hill), Decland Mullholland (Saunders), and
Philip Ross (Hospital Attendant)

"Steed puts out a light- Emma takes fright."

The ceramic business world is endangered when four ceramic execs have suddenly lost their minds. Each man had decided to decline the British Porcelain Company's offer to merge. Who's making the men insane and why?

Teaser: Steed brings Emma a box of chocolates with a card stating "Mrs. Peel, we're needed."

Tag: Back at Emma's, Steed's biggest fear is revealed: no more champagne.

Notes: Emma wears her black jumpsuit. There's a picture on her page. Steed has an answering machine, which is called a 'recording device'.
